I dunno about his setup at Moon, but Markus uses DVDJs now for some vocal tracks and controls it himself...so he needs a monitor plus a a simple (but professional) video switcher....basically there's a lever on the switcher...Video A + Video B. Video A is his standard DVD looping....when he plays a track that he's gonna use a the DVDJ for, he fades it over to Video B and the DVDJ video passes through tot he screen.

You can see the setup here from his SF gig:

Looks like he use an Edirol (aka Roland) V-4. Very common video fader. The fader can be horizontal liket his, some are vertical...I've even see the fader look like a DJ mixer crossfader too, and not a huge knob. If you look at the fader area, it can be easily switched out with a different one...just takes those four screws!
